(7,-1) and ( 21,-5) what is the slope

Respuesta :

altavistard
altavistard altavistard
  • 08-09-2020

Answer:

-2/7

Step-by-step explanation:

Going from (7,-1) to ( 21,-5) we see x (the 'run') increasing by 14 and y (the 'rise') decreasing by 4.  Thus, the slope of the line connecting these two points is m = rise/run = -4/14, or -2/7.
